Hi,

Yes, you cannot convert your family visa into an employment visa without exiting the country. But your children's visas can be transferred from yours to your husbands. But they would have to exit (cancel the existing visa) and reenter on fresh visas.

Got it now.but we are not eligible for fresh resident visa as per new rule basic salary should be 600omr,so fresh visa for my kids not possible.is there any possibility?

Hi rojavenkat,

The minimum salary criteria for sponsoring families is applicable ONLY to those who are going to be coming in new.

This rules is waived for all those who are already residing in the Sultanate. So don't worry. This rule is not applicable in your case.
